Amino Acid Profile Testing in Livestock Nutrition
The amino acid profile plays a critical role in understanding the nutritional requirements of livestock. Amino acids are the building blocks of proteins, and their availability directly influences the health, productivity, and growth rates of animals. In the context of livestock nutrition, accurate testing is essential for formulating feeds that meet these needs precisely.

Accurate amino acid profiling is crucial for optimizing feed efficiency, reducing waste, and improving overall animal health. For instance, inadequate levels of certain essential amino acids can lead to suboptimal growth rates or increased susceptibility to disease. Conversely, excessive intake may result in unnecessary costs and environmental impacts.
